Industrial Safety Systems Market Projected to Reach $2.5B by 2035
Accelerated automation and semiconductor expansion are driving a shift toward integrated safety infrastructure.
The global market for industrial safety systems and guarding is entering a period of sustained growth as manufacturers integrate advanced automation. This expansion is driven by the dual pressures of scaling high-tech production and meeting increasingly stringent occupational health and safety requirements.
According to data from Wiseguy Reports, the semiconductor safety services market is projected to grow from USD 1,023 million in 2025 to USD 2,500 million by 2035. This trajectory represents a compound annual growth rate (CAGR) of 9.3%. Parallel to this, Market Research Future reports that industrial automation services are projected to grow at a CAGR of 13.58% from 2026 to 2035, fueled by the widespread adoption of robotics, artificial intelligence, and the Industrial Internet of Things (IIoT).
The Shift to Industry 4.0
This growth is rooted in the broader transition toward Industry 4.0, where traditional manufacturing is being replaced by highly digitized, autonomous environments. In sectors like semiconductor fabrication, the introduction of high-speed machinery and complex robotic arms has rendered simple physical barriers insufficient. To maintain compliance with international safety standards and minimize workplace accidents, firms are transitioning toward integrated safety systems that can react in real-time to human presence and machine movement.
